What the Alternator Is and How It Works
The alternator is part of your vehicle’s charging system. Because the battery alone cannot continuously power the vehicle, the alternator creates electricity while the engine runs. So, it helps keep your vehicle operating correctly.
Then, the engine turns the alternator using a drive belt. Next, the alternator converts movement into electrical energy. Also, that energy powers vehicle electronics and recharges the battery. Because this process continues while driving, your vehicle stays ready for the road.

How to Maintain the Alternator
Simple habits can help keep your alternator working properly:
- Because battery condition affects charging performance, inspect the battery regularly.
- So, keep battery terminals clean and secure.
- Also, inspect the drive belt for wear.
- Then, address dashboard warning lights quickly.
- Because electrical issues can affect charging performance, repair concerns early.
- So, schedule routine charging system inspections.
- Additionally, inspect electrical connections during maintenance visits.

When to See a Mechanic
So, visit Meineke in Ramsey if you notice these warning signs:
- Because the battery warning light comes on.
- So, headlights become dim or flicker.
- Also, electronics stop working correctly.
- Then, the engine struggles to start.
- Because unusual noises develop near the engine.
- So, the vehicle struggles during drives near Route 17 or Interstate 287.
- Additionally, the battery loses charge repeatedly.
